Madrid, 1855. The Cibeles fountain still appears in its original location, next to Paseo de Recoletos. The water carriers load their carts with water that they would then distribute throughout the city. More than fifty were supplied at the fountain of the goddess. Neither the Bank of Spain nor the Army headquarters are yet there.
